Qu'est-ce que l'UTXO - Comprendre le mécanisme de base des transactions Bitcoin

Dans le monde des cryptomonnaies, qu’est-ce que l’UTXO est l’une des questions que toute personne intéressée par Bitcoin doit comprendre. Si vous vous êtes déjà demandé pourquoi les frais de transaction varient ou comment Bitcoin empêche la double dépense, la réponse réside dans l’UTXO - Unspent Transaction Output (Sortie de transaction non dépensée). Comprendre ce qu’est l’UTXO vous aidera à optimiser vos coûts et à améliorer votre stratégie de transaction.

Résumé rapide : qu’est-ce que l’UTXO

  • L’UTXO agit comme une “restante” dans les transactions Bitcoin, similaire à la monnaie excédentaire que vous recevez lors d’un paiement en espèces
  • Chaque UTXO ne peut être utilisé qu’une seule fois, ce qui empêche la double dépense et sécurise le réseau
  • Plus il y a d’UTXO dans une transaction, plus les frais sont élevés car le réseau doit traiter une quantité de données plus importante
  • Combiner des UTXO lors de périodes de faibles frais permet de réduire les coûts de transaction futurs
  • Le modèle UTXO offre un contrôle et une confidentialité accrus par rapport au modèle basé sur les comptes

Qu’est-ce que l’UTXO et pourquoi est-il important pour Bitcoin

Pour comprendre ce qu’est l’UTXO, imaginez que vous achetez quelque chose en magasin et payez en liquide. Si vous donnez plus d’argent que le prix, le caissier vous rendra la monnaie. Dans le système Bitcoin, l’UTXO fonctionne selon un principe similaire - c’est la partie de Bitcoin non dépensée qui reste après une transaction.

Contrairement à un compte bancaire classique (où vous avez un solde total), le modèle Bitcoin suit chaque “unité” individuelle de Bitcoin. Chaque unité est une UTXO - représentant une quantité de Bitcoin que vous contrôlez entièrement via votre clé privée.

Fonctionnement de l’UTXO dans une transaction Bitcoin

Le processus UTXO dans une transaction Bitcoin se déroule en plusieurs étapes :

Étape 1 : Identification des UTXO disponibles

Lorsque vous souhaitez envoyer des Bitcoin, votre portefeuille recherche les UTXO disponibles (c’est-à-dire les Bitcoin non dépensés). Ces UTXO ressemblent aux “pièces” numériques que vous détenez.

Étape 2 : Sélection des UTXO pour la transaction

Le réseau Bitcoin choisira un ou plusieurs UTXO de votre portefeuille pour couvrir le montant à envoyer. Par exemple, si vous souhaitez envoyer 0,6 BTC et que votre portefeuille possède deux UTXO de 0,5 BTC et 0,3 BTC, le système combinera les deux pour réaliser la transaction.

Étape 3 : Création de nouvelles sorties

Après l’envoi, les UTXO utilisés seront “désactivés” - ils ne pourront plus être réutilisés. À la place, le réseau crée deux nouvelles sorties :

  • Sortie de réception : 0,6 BTC transférés au destinataire
  • Sortie de changement : le reste (moins les frais réseau) est renvoyé à votre portefeuille sous forme de nouvelle UTXO

Ce processus se répète à chaque transaction, formant une chaîne continue d’UTXO.

UTXO et impact direct sur les frais de transaction Bitcoin

Un aspect pratique essentiel à comprendre sur l’UTXO est son influence sur le coût des transactions. Les frais Bitcoin ne dépendent pas uniquement du montant envoyé, mais aussi de la façon dont ils sont organisés en UTXO.

Pourquoi plusieurs UTXO entraînent-ils des frais plus élevés ?

Chaque UTXO utilisé dans une transaction augmente la taille de celle-ci. Plus la transaction est volumineuse = plus le réseau doit traiter de données = frais plus élevés.

Imaginez que vous devez payer 100 USD. Si vous avez deux billets de 50 USD, c’est simple. Mais si vous n’avez que 100 pièces de 1 cent, il faut compter chaque pièce, ce qui prend plus de temps. De même, le réseau Bitcoin doit traiter plus longtemps si vous utilisez 100 UTXO petits au lieu de 2 UTXO plus gros.

Moins d’UTXO = frais plus faibles

Si votre portefeuille est organisé de manière compacte avec peu de gros UTXO, vos transactions seront plus petites et plus faciles à traiter, ce qui réduit les frais. C’est pourquoi “fusionner” des UTXO lors de périodes de faibles frais est une stratégie intelligente.

Stratégie de réduction des frais : fusionner les UTXO

Une méthode efficace pour réduire les coûts futurs est de fusionner de petits UTXO en UTXO plus gros lorsque les frais réseau sont faibles. Ainsi, les transactions suivantes nécessiteront moins d’inputs, diminuant considérablement les frais.

Pourquoi l’UTXO constitue la base de la sécurité de Bitcoin

Comprendre ce qu’est l’UTXO revient aussi à comprendre comment Bitcoin protège ses utilisateurs contre les menaces potentielles.

Empêcher la double dépense - le plus grand défi des monnaies numériques

La double dépense est la menace principale pour tout système de monnaie numérique. Elle survient lorsqu’une personne tente d’utiliser la même somme plusieurs fois. L’UTXO résout élégamment ce problème :

Chaque UTXO ne peut être dépensé qu’une seule fois. Après utilisation dans une transaction, il devient “déjà dépensé” et ne peut plus être réutilisé. Le réseau rejettera toute tentative de réutilisation du même UTXO.

Transparence sur la blockchain

Chaque transaction sur Bitcoin est publique et chaque nœud du réseau peut la vérifier. Étant donné que l’UTXO suit chaque sortie individuellement, il est fiable et transparent de vérifier qui possède quoi. Cela crée un registre comptable numérique inviolable.

Confidentialité accrue grâce à la structure UTXO

Contrairement à un compte bancaire où tout l’argent est centralisé, l’UTXO permet de diviser votre solde en plusieurs parties. Cela complique le suivi de toutes vos activités, offrant une couche supplémentaire de protection de la vie privée.

Comparaison entre UTXO et le modèle basé sur les comptes

Bien que Bitcoin utilise l’UTXO, tous les blockchains ne le font pas. Ethereum, par exemple, utilise un modèle basé sur les comptes. Comprendre cette différence vous aidera à saisir pourquoi l’UTXO est choisi pour Bitcoin.

Modèle UTXO (Bitcoin)

  • Suit chaque “monnaie” individuellement - comme de l’argent liquide
  • Chaque transaction utilise des UTXO spécifiques comme entrées et crée de nouvelles UTXO comme sorties
  • Le reste devient automatiquement une nouvelle UTXO dans votre portefeuille
  • Offre un contrôle précis et une meilleure confidentialité

Modèle basé sur les comptes (Ethereum)

  • Fonctionne comme un compte bancaire traditionnel - ne suit que le solde total
  • Chaque transaction modifie directement le solde du compte
  • Plus simple conceptuellement, car familier aux utilisateurs
  • Moins de contrôle précis, mais plus facile à comprendre

Principales différences

Aspect UTXO (Bitcoin) Modèle basé sur les comptes (Ethereum)
Détails Suit chaque coin Suit uniquement le solde total
Confidentialité Élevée - chaque transaction crée une nouvelle sortie Moins élevée - plus facile à suivre
Scalabilité Bonne - traite moins de données Peut être congestionné
Complexité Plus complexe à gérer Plus simple, intuitif

Aucun modèle n’est “meilleur” en soi - ils sont conçus pour des usages différents. L’UTXO offre un contrôle et une confidentialité supérieurs, tandis que le modèle basé sur les comptes est plus facile à utiliser pour des applications complexes.

Guide pratique : comment optimiser votre UTXO

Connaître l’UTXO est une chose, mais comment appliquer cette connaissance concrètement ?

Surveiller le nombre d’UTXO dans votre portefeuille

Certains portefeuilles permettent de voir le nombre d’UTXO. Si vous avez beaucoup de petits UTXO, cela peut indiquer qu’il est temps de les fusionner.

Fusionner les UTXO lors de faibles frais

Lorsque les frais réseau Bitcoin sont faibles (souvent le week-end ou en période de faible activité), effectuez une transaction pour vous envoyer de l’argent à vous-même. Cela combine plusieurs petits UTXO en un seul gros, réduisant les coûts pour les transactions futures.

Utiliser un portefeuille permettant de choisir les UTXO

Certains portefeuilles avancés permettent de sélectionner des UTXO spécifiques pour chaque transaction. Cela vous aide à optimiser la taille de la transaction et à gérer efficacement les frais.

Conclusion

L’UTXO n’est pas seulement une notion technique, c’est la pierre angulaire du fonctionnement de Bitcoin. De la prévention de la double dépense à l’impact sur les frais de transaction, l’UTXO agit silencieusement chaque fois que vous envoyez ou recevez des Bitcoin.

En comprenant ce qu’est l’UTXO et son fonctionnement, vous devenez non seulement un utilisateur plus intelligent de Bitcoin, mais vous pouvez aussi optimiser vos coûts, renforcer votre confidentialité et gérer plus efficacement votre patrimoine numérique.

Foire aux questions

Qu’est-ce que l’UTXO en termes simples ?
L’UTXO est la “restante” non dépensée d’une transaction Bitcoin. Comme la monnaie excédentaire que vous recevez en payant en liquide, l’UTXO est un Bitcoin non utilisé pouvant servir dans une transaction suivante.

Pourquoi le modèle UTXO est-il crucial pour la sécurité ?
L’UTXO empêche la double dépense en garantissant que chaque UTXO ne peut être utilisé qu’une seule fois. Après utilisation, il devient “déjà dépensé” et ne peut être réutilisé, protégeant la sécurité du réseau Bitcoin.

Comment l’UTXO influence-t-il les frais de transaction ?
Plus il y a d’UTXO dans une transaction, plus celle-ci est volumineuse = frais plus élevés. Moins d’UTXO signifie une transaction plus petite et des frais plus faibles.

Comment réduire les frais liés à l’UTXO ?
Fusionner des petits UTXO en UTXO plus gros lors de périodes de faibles frais. Cela réduit la taille de la transaction future, diminuant ainsi les coûts.

Quelle différence entre UTXO et un compte bancaire ?
L’UTXO suit chaque “monnaie” individuellement (comme de l’argent liquide), tandis qu’un compte bancaire ne suit que le solde total. L’UTXO offre un meilleur contrôle mais est plus complexe à gérer.

Voir l'original
Cette page peut inclure du contenu de tiers fourni à des fins d'information uniquement. Gate ne garantit ni l'exactitude ni la validité de ces contenus, n’endosse pas les opinions exprimées, et ne fournit aucun conseil financier ou professionnel à travers ces informations. Voir la section Avertissement pour plus de détails.
  • Récompense
  • Commentaire
  • Reposter
  • Partager
Commentaire
0/400
Aucun commentaire
  • Épingler

Trader les cryptos partout et à tout moment
qrCode
Scan pour télécharger Gate app
Communauté
Français (Afrique)
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)